Maquet recalls pediatric packs with batch numbers 3000046123 and 3000059176 due to potential sterility issues during sterilization. Affected units may not meet sterility standards after processing.
Custom Tubing Sets for Extracorporeal Circulation (ECC)-During sterilization, the closed stopcock/non-vented cap configuration may prevent the flow of humidity/ethylene oxide gas into the fluid-path between the closed port and the non-vented cap therefore the Sterility Assurance Level (SAL) of the stopcock ports cannot be assured

Check for batch numbers 3000046123 or 3000059176 on the pediatric packs. The product is labeled as Maquet Getinge-BEQ-T 8069 Pediatric Pack with material code 701064965.
